The probate process can take as few as a few months, but a majority of take prolonged as some time to effective. On average, probate takes about 9 months to complete. In complex situations, it isn't unusual for probate to last eighteen months to 3 years. Without a living trust, your family could spend months, or years in probate courts paying for legal acrobatics. There a wide range of sad stories of families struggling while using probate system for years without regarding bank webpage. A Living Trust shields your loved ones from such agony.
